Output 50e3feeecbccad9a050778d3f4b214cc603cc5ba55187ba4ad98b3dd8ec48648:4

value
378960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dedc048ae03ef0208f157bd7c7c02ed31824391c OP_EQUAL
address
3N1PWEMDz5hp3bHscEstFDvHnp7vg333H9
transaction
50e3feeecbccad9a050778d3f4b214cc603cc5ba55187ba4ad98b3dd8ec48648
spent
true